4-h members and any other youth ages 9-19 Rules: 1. All canned fruit / vegetables MUST be displayed in cleaned and sealed standard pint jars. Only standard Kerr, Ball, Mason, etc. pint jars will be accepted. Jars must have a new/clean ring on the lid. 2. Exhibits must be labeled with the date of food preservation and method of preservation. Method must state whether canned in water bath, pressure canned or other – Entries without required labeling will not be judged. Labels will be placed on the entry tag at the time of entry. Labels are available from the County Extension Office prior to the fair and at the fairgrounds at check-in. 3. Current USDA guidelines are recommended. Judging will follow USDA guidelines. 4. All foods must have been canned /dried within the last 12 months but at least 1 week before the fair. 5. Peppers and jellies may be entered in ½ pint jars. 6. No products, including pickles should use food coloring except specialty pickle products. 7. Dried foods should be exhibited in standard pint or ½ pint canning jars with lids and rings. Jars should not be sealed. 8. Fancy packs are discouraged. 9. No canned squash including summer, zucchini, or spaghetti, pureed or mashed pumpkin, sweet potatoes or potatoes will be judged. Pickled summer squash or zucchini are allowed.
